Arctic soil reveals climate change clues

Wednesday, October 8, 2008 - 09:14 in Earth & Climate

Frozen arctic soil contains nearly twice the greenhouse-gas-producing organic material as was previously estimated, according to recently published research by University of Alaska Fairbanks scientists.
